Apple mousse

Preparation

Step 1
Wash the apples and cut them into pieces, keeping the pips and skin.
Put them in a saucepan with the sugar, the spirit, and the zest and juice of the lemon, and cook, covered, for 20 minutes.
Then pass the compote through a food mill or a smoothie maker (if you’re in a hurry, blitz it with a stick blender).
Leave it to cool in the fridge for a few hours.
Before serving, whip the cream to soft peaks. Gently fold it into the apple compote.
Serve the mousse in small glasses, with speculoos-type biscuits if you like.
